What do different painted nails mean?

What do different painted nails mean?

Painted nails have become a popular way for people to express themselves and make a statement. The colors and designs chosen can signify different meanings and reflect aspects of the wearer’s personality. This guide will explore some of the most common nail polish shades and patterns worn today, and what they typically represent.

Solid Color Meanings

Here are some of the messages solid nail polish colors tend to convey:

Red

This bold and fiery hue often represents:

– Confidence – Red nails show the wearer is bold, daring, and full of self-assurance.

– Power – Associated with strength and authority, red nails command attention.

– Passion – Red conveys intense emotions like love, desire, and lust.

– Energy – Vibrant red nails signal vitality and zest for life.

Pink

Pretty in pink nails tend to signify:

– Femininity – Pink is seen as a traditionally feminine color, evoking sweetness and romance.

– Playfulness – Pastel pink nails have a soft, whimsical vibe.

– Hope – As a blend of red and white, pink also symbolizes optimism.

– Self-love – Light pink polish indicates the wearer values herself.

Nude

These neutral, skin-toned nails are linked with:

– Simplicity – Nude nails give off an understated, natural look.

– Professionalism – In work contexts, nude polish has a polished, put-together image.

– Cleanliness – The pale color evokes associations with hygiene and purity.

– Practicality – Nude is considered a “safe” color unlikely to chip or stain.

Black

No color makes a statement quite like black nail polish:

– Boldness – Black nails convey the wearer is brave, daring, and has a rebellious spirit.

– Mystery – The dark shade signals someone who is complex and intriguing.

– Sophistication – Black also represents elegance and luxury.

– Defiance – Wearing “unorthodox” black polish can be an act of rebellion.

French Manicure Meaning

This style, featuring pale nails tipped with white, usually represents:

– Femininity – The delicate tips evoke traditional female beauty ideals.

– Elegance – French manicures give off an aura of grace and sophistication.

– Cleanliness – The crisp white tips connote hygiene and precision.

– Practicality – The natural look appeals to those wanting an attractive, low-maintenance nail.

Glitter Nail Polish Meaning

Adding some sparkle with glitter polish conveys:

– Playfulness – Glitter nails have a fun, lighthearted vibe perfect for parties.

– Boldness – The eye-catching sparkle makes a flashy statement.

– Optimism – The shimmer and shine signal happiness and hope.

– Creativity – Glitter allows artistic self-expression and experimentation.
